Product details

Overview

CY7C1513KV18-333BZI from Cypress Semiconductor is a 4M × 18, 72-Mbit QDR® II SRAM with separate read/write ports, 333 MHz clock operation (666 MHz DDR data rate), 1.8 V core supply, and 1.4–1.8 V I/O supply. It delivers concurrent read/write transactions with four-word burst architecture and echo clocks (CQ/CQ) for high-speed data capture in networking packet buffers and baseband memory subsystems.

Technical Context

The CY7C1513KV18-333BZI implements QDR II architecture with fully independent synchronous read and write ports sharing a multiplexed 20-bit address bus. Read and write operations are latched on alternate rising edges of the K clock, enabling true concurrency without bus turnaround.

It uses dual output clocks (C and C) plus echo clocks (CQ and CQ) to compensate for PCB flight-time skew, and integrates a PLL for precise data placement relative to clock edges. The device supports programmable drive strength and JTAG 1149.1 boundary scan for production testability.

Key Specifications

ParameterValue and Actual Design Meaning
Memory Density72 Mbit (4M × 18 organization)
Max Clock Frequency333 MHz - enables 666 MT/s DDR throughput per port
Core Supply Voltage1.8 V ±0.1 V - defines minimum power rail stability requirement
I/O Supply Range1.4 V to 1.8 V - supports HSTL-compatible signaling at 1.5 V or 1.8 V
Read Latency1 cycle (DOFF = LOW) or 1.5 cycles (DOFF = HIGH) - determines pipeline depth in controller design
Burst LengthFour-word - reduces effective address bus toggling frequency by 4×
Package165-ball FBGA (13 × 15 × 1.4 mm) - standard footprint for high-density routing

Pinout & Package

Package: 165-ball fine-pitch ball grid array (FBGA), 13 mm × 15 mm × 1.4 mm body, RoHS-compliant, 0.8 mm ball pitch.

Pin/TerminalCircuit RoleDesign Meaning
D[17:0]Synchronous write data input18-bit parallel data sampled on rising edge of K/K; enables full-word or byte-selectable writes via BWS[1:0]
Q[17:0]Synchronous read data output18-bit parallel data driven on rising edge of C/C; tristated when RPS is deasserted
K / KInput clock pairRising edges latch all synchronous inputs (address, control, data); K only used for timing in single-clock mode
C / COutput clock pairControl timing of Q[17:0] output; used with CQ/CQ for deskewed capture at controller
CQ / CQEcho clock outputsReplicate C/C timing at device output pins to simplify controller's source-synchronous capture
RPS / WPSPort select controlsActive-low signals enabling independent read/write port activation; support depth expansion
BWS[1:0]Byte write selectsTwo active-low signals controlling D[8:0] and D[17:9] respectively; allow partial-word writes without read-modify-write
DOFFRead latency modeHigh = 1.5-cycle latency (pipelined), Low = 1-cycle latency (QDR I–compatible behavior)

Key Features

FeatureDesign Value
Separate read/write data pathsEliminates bus turnaround overhead, enabling sustained 666 MT/s bidirectional bandwidth
Four-word burst architectureReduces required address transition rate by 75%, easing timing closure on address bus
Programmable DOFF latency modeAllows system-level trade-off between latency (1 cycle) and throughput (1.5-cycle pipelined)
HSTL Class I–compatible I/OSupports 1.5 V or 1.8 V VDDQ with variable drive strength for signal integrity tuning
JTAG 1149.1 boundary scanEnables automated test and interconnect verification in assembled systems

Applications

Packet Buffer MemoryBaseband Processing Memory

Use Scenario: High-throughput line cards in 10G/40G Ethernet switches buffering ingress/egress packets with strict latency constraints.

IC Role / Device Role / Timing Role: Dual-port SRAM serving as zero-turnaround packet buffer with concurrent read (transmit path) and write (receive path) access.

Use Value: 666 MT/s DDR bandwidth per port sustains full line-rate traffic without backpressure; echo clocks ensure reliable capture at FPGA PHY interfaces.

Use Scenario: LTE/5G remote radio units requiring low-latency, deterministic memory access for FFT/IFFT and channel estimation pipelines.

IC Role / Device Role / Timing Role: Synchronous memory co-processor interfacing with DSP/FPGA, providing pipelined read data with configurable 1- or 1.5-cycle latency.

Use Value: DOFF-selectable latency allows alignment with algorithm pipeline stages; BWS[1:0] enables efficient coefficient updates without full-word overwrites.

Network Processor CacheTest Equipment Pattern Memory

Use Scenario: Embedded network processors performing deep packet inspection where metadata and payload must be accessed concurrently.

IC Role / Device Role / Timing Role: On-chip cache extension with independent read (rule lookup) and write (payload store) ports operating at same clock domain.

Use Value: Full data coherency guarantees most recent payload is available during rule-match evaluation; no software-managed coherence required.

Use Scenario: Automated test equipment generating high-speed stimulus patterns and capturing response waveforms simultaneously.

IC Role / Device Role / Timing Role: Deterministic pattern storage with synchronized read (output waveform) and write (input capture) under shared clocking.

Use Value: PLL-synchronized timing ensures sub-nanosecond jitter between stimulus generation and response sampling clocks.

Equivalent & Alternatives

The following parts are listed as comparable options for similar QDR II SRAM applications.

Alternative PartTechnical DifferenceApplication DifferenceSelection Advice
CY7C1513KV18-300BZILower max clock (300 MHz → 600 MT/s DDR), reduced IDD (570 mA vs. 620 mA @ 333 MHz)Acceptable where 666 MT/s not required; lower power and thermal loadSelect when system timing margin permits 300 MHz operation and power budget is constrained
AS7C3256A-15JCINAsynchronous 256K × 16 SRAM; no DDR, no echo clocks, no DOFF latency controlOnly suitable for non-concurrent, lower-bandwidth applications with relaxed timingNot a functional replacement; consider only if QDR II features are unnecessary and cost is primary driver

Compared with CY7C1513KV18-333BZI, the -300BZI variant trades 66 MT/s bandwidth for lower power and improved timing margin, while the AS7C3256A lacks QDR II's concurrency, DDR, and echo clocking-making it unsuitable for high-speed networking or baseband use cases.

Cypress Semiconductor (now part of Infineon Technologies) designs high-performance memory and programmable solutions for networking, automotive, and industrial systems, with emphasis on signal integrity and timing precision.

The QDR® II SRAM product line targets high-bandwidth, low-latency memory subsystems in communications infrastructure-specifically engineered to eliminate bus turnaround and support deterministic DDR capture in FPGA- and ASIC-based datapaths.

FAQ

What is the function of the DOFF pin on CY7C1513KV18-333BZI?

The DOFF (Data Output OFFset) pin configures read latency mode: when asserted HIGH, it enables 1.5-cycle pipelined read latency for maximum throughput; when LOW, it reverts to 1-cycle latency matching QDR I behavior. This setting directly affects controller pipeline depth and must be fixed at power-up; it is not dynamically switchable during operation.

Can CY7C1513KV18-333BZI operate with 1.5 V I/O supply?

Yes, the device supports VDDQ from 1.4 V to 1.8 V, including 1.5 V nominal. Its HSTL Class I–compatible output drivers are designed for this range, and DC/AC electrical characteristics-including setup/hold times and output swing-are fully specified at 1.5 V. No configuration register or external resistor is needed to enable 1.5 V operation.

How does the CY7C1513KV18-333BZI handle concurrent read and write to the same address?

The device guarantees full data coherency: a read access returns the most recently written data, even if the write is still in progress within the same burst cycle. Internally, the write path is pipelined and self-timed, and the read path samples the memory array after write completion-ensuring reads always reflect the latest valid write without software intervention.

What is the purpose of the CQ and CQ echo clocks?

CQ and CQ are output-replica clocks synchronized to C and C, respectively, and routed alongside Q[17:0] signals. They allow the receiving controller to perform source-synchronous capture using the same clock edge that launched the data, eliminating need for board-level clock-data skew compensation. This is critical for reliable 666 MT/s DDR operation across temperature and voltage variations.
